Transaction 3394bebe3913df9a98d6d15e7c44630d4c4579ac4cf4ac5160c68842c567a8a9
1 Input
1 Output
-
3394bebe3913df9a98d6d15e7c44630d4c4579ac4cf4ac5160c68842c567a8a9:0
- value
- 590237
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ecd1827a76a1bea4cc5997d28c86746b4dd15c7e
- address
- bc1qangcy7nk5xl2fnzejlfgepn5ddxazhr7ljgdej